As you might guess, this is a little bit of shenanigans. It's completely true, but as we've learned in the past, there are ways to manipulate Google to do this.

A few years ago, facing a massive revolt of unhappy customers, Reddit users joined forces and attributed the Nazi flag to Comcast enough online that when you Googled 'Comcast,' swastikas would come back as the official company logo.
